Safety & Risk Elimination

We protect your family, guests, and vessel by addressing the root cause of failures, not just the symptoms. Our technicians perform GFCI/ELCI testing, check bonding and grounding, and follow NEC Article 555 and UL 943 guidance for marina/dock electrical. We isolate faults causing nuisance trips or stray current.

Mechanically, we correct cable routing, sheave alignment, and load balance to prevent sudden drops or cable bird-nesting. Example: a Clear Lake client’s lift was binding and out of level by 1.5 inches. We re-spooled new 316 stainless cable, replaced HDPE pulleys, and leveled the cradle - restoring quiet, safe operation.

Professional Results & Quality

Our work holds up because we use the right materials and techniques. We specify galvanized or 316 stainless cable as the water conditions demand, use NEMA 4X control enclosures, tinned copper marine wire, and hot-dipped galvanized or stainless hardware with anti-seize application. Every fastener is torqued to spec with logs you can keep.

We set cable tension with a laser level for equalization, align motors and gearboxes, and verify smooth cradle travel under load. Expect neat wiring with proper strain relief, UV-resistant motor covers, and corrosion control that reduces maintenance needs over time.

Certified Marine Electrical & Safety Compliance

Waterfront electrical work demands precision. We follow NFPA 70 (NEC) and NEC Article 555 for marinas and boatyards, implement ABYC E-11 practices, and verify GFCI protection per UL 943. During repairs we test for stray current, confirm bonding/grounding, and correct dock wiring issues that can damage equipment or trip breakers.

We handle NEC 555 GFCI boat lift electrical repair Houston scenarios routinely - control box faults, moisture intrusion, and miswired receptacles. Expect clean, labeled wiring with NEMA 4X enclosures and tinned copper conductors for long-term reliability.

Local Knowledge: Saltwater and Freshwater

Houston’s waterfronts vary widely. On Galveston Bay and Clear Lake, we prioritize corrosion control with sacrificial anodes, sealed terminations, and stainless fasteners. On Lake Conroe and Lake Livingston, we focus on seasonal level changes, wind fetch, and dock movement that affect cable equalization.

We tailor materials and service intervals to your location and usage so your lift lasts longer with fewer surprises.

How often should I service my boat or jet ski lift?
Most lifts benefit from a full inspection and tune-up at least once per year, or every 50–75 cycles. In saltwater (Clear Lake, Galveston Bay), consider every 6–9 months due to corrosion. Freshwater lifts on Lake Conroe and Lake Houston usually do well with annual service. Can you perform NEC 555/GFCI dock electrical safety inspections during a lift service visit?
Absolutely. We test GFCI/ELCI devices, verify bonding and grounding, inspect control boxes, and correct wiring per NEC Article 555 and ABYC E‑11 practices. Many “motor won’t run” calls trace to moisture‑damaged receptacles or miswired circuits. We’ll document findings and recommend upgrades like NEMA 4X enclosures to reduce future trips.
How often should boat lift cables be replaced?
In saltwater, plan for 316 stainless or galvanized cable replacement every 2–3 years depending on use and rinsing habits. In freshwater, 3–5 years is common. If you see broken strands, rust, flat spots, or uneven wrap, schedule service. Do I need a permit to install or modify a lift in Texas?
Permits vary by location. Lake Conroe often requires SJRA approval; coastal projects may need Texas GLO and, in some cases, USACE authorization. Counties and cities may require building or electrical permits. We’ll help identify what applies and can assist with submittals so your upgrade proceeds smoothly.
